What companies run services between Waterloo Station, England and Maida Vale Studios,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Waterloo station to Warwick Avenue station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£3–14 and the journey takes 16 min. Alternatively, London Buses operates a bus from Trafalgar Square to Sutherland Avenue Westbourne Green every 30 minutes. Tickets cost £2–4 and the journey takes 25 min.
